Episode 103: Hiking After Knee Replacement (How to Prepare for Hills, Uneven Ground, and Longer Distances)

When Two Miles on a Trail Feels Nothing Like Two Miles at Home

A trail can turn an ordinary walking distance into a very different outing. Hiking after knee replacement involves more than mileage because elevation, downhill control, uneven ground, weather, and the route back to the car all shape the physical demand.

Hiking After Knee Replacement Starts With the Route

Research offers good reason for optimism. A 2017 Austrian trial followed 48 people after total knee replacement. Twenty-five participated in a guided three-month hiking program two or three times a week. That group improved in several functional and quality-of-life measures, with no acute harmful effects reported during the study period (Hepperger et al., 2017).

In a 2025 Australian study, 96 people returned to bushwalking, the Australian term for hiking on natural trails. That represented 84 percent of the participants who had gone bushwalking before surgery (Sarrami et al., 2025). Your starting route still needs to fit your health, walking ability, strength, balance, experience, stage of healing, and guidance from your surgeon or physical therapist.

Find Out What the Trail Is Really Like

Begin with the official website for the park, forest, preserve, or trail system. Check the route description, current alerts, closures, parking information, and the distance from the parking area to the trailhead. A reputable trail app may add an elevation profile, recent photos, and reports from people who have completed the route.

  • Distance: Confirm whether the mileage is one way or round trip. Include the walk from the car and any side trips.
  • Route type: An out-and-back lets you choose a turnaround point. A loop may require you to complete the full route.
  • Elevation: Look at total elevation gain and where the climbs and descents occur. Five hundred feet spread across five miles feels different from the same gain packed into one mile.
  • Terrain: Read beyond easy, moderate, or hard. Look for pavement, packed dirt, gravel, roots, rocks, mud, natural steps, side slopes, stream crossings, and exposed edges.
  • Current conditions: Recent rain, fallen trees, heat, cold, wind, or trail damage can change the route.
  • Exit options: Identify shortcuts, benches, shelters, turnaround landmarks, and the easiest way back to the car.

Prepare for Hills and Uneven Ground

Compare the route with the walking you do now. Familiar pavement provides information about distance and general endurance. Trails add hills, variable step heights, changing surfaces, and repeated adjustments at your feet, ankles, knees, hips, and trunk.

When possible, change one demand at a time. You might try a gentle hill before a route with a long climb, walk on a maintained dirt path before several miles of roots and rocks, or carry a light daypack on familiar ground before bringing it onto a trail.

Downhill walking deserves separate attention. Your muscles control your body as you lower from one step to the next, and steeper slopes increase the demand around your knees. Studies have found changes in knee motion, loading, and muscle performance during downhill walking and hiking after total knee replacement (Bleuel et al., 2024; Wen et al., 2022). A physical therapist may assess strength, balance, step control, and walking form when those skills affect the route you want to complete.

Footwear, Trekking Poles, and a Light Pack

Wear footwear that fits the route and already feels comfortable. Check the tread, heel fit, toe room, pressure points, and how the fit changes if your operated leg or foot becomes more swollen during the day.

Trekking poles are optional. Research suggests they may reduce some forces through the lower extremities during downhill walking while increasing upper-body work and overall energy use (Bohne and Abendroth-Smith, 2007; Hawke and Jensen, 2020). Practice adjusting the length and coordinating the poles with your steps on familiar ground first.

Plan the Outing and Watch Your Response

Check the forecast and current trail alerts shortly before leaving. Bring water, identification, a charged phone, necessary medication, and supplies appropriate for the route. Tell someone where you are going and when you expect to return.

Choose a likely turnaround point before starting. Repeated toe catching, a growing limp, increasing pain, greater reliance on the poles, or fading balance may be reasons to shorten the outing. Remember that the turnaround point on an out-and-back route is only halfway.

Monitor how your knee responds later that day and the following morning. Some muscle fatigue or a temporarily stiff knee may follow a new challenge. A marked increase in swelling, loss of motion, worsening pain, or altered walking that continues into the next day could indicate that the outing exceeded your current capacity. If you can, change one part of the next hike, such as the distance, elevation, pace, terrain, or pack weight.

When to Contact Your Surgeon or Physical Therapist

Persistent pain, swelling, repeated buckling, or declining walking ability deserves evaluation. A fall with injury, sudden inability to bear weight, sudden sharp pain, or a new sense that your knee will not support you needs prompt medical attention and a safe exit from the trail.

This list is not exhaustive and is not a substitute for medical judgment. If something feels wrong to you, even if it isn’t listed here, contact your surgeon or another qualified healthcare provider rather than waiting to see if it fits a category.

The Bottom Line

Choose a trail whose distance, elevation, terrain, and return route fit what you can do today. Prepare for the demands you have not practiced yet, use your response to guide the next outing, and keep the bigger trail on your list.
